On target tips - excerpt from Forbes; Why You Should Run Your Business Like a Non-Profit, by Dan Ehrenkrantz
#1 Focus on the Mission First - Then the Money
Nonprofits need to generate revenue to fulfill their mission, and just like a successful business - must recognize how their service fills a need in the world. A company’s social values create the cornerstone of its appeal to all constituencies: customers, employees, shareholders. In the process, just like a good nonprofit, it reaps the same benefits: public admiration, motivated and dedicated employees, and satisfaction from doing good in the world.
#2 Treat Employees Like Your Best Volunteers
Daniel Pink, in his bestselling book Drive, tells us that money is a motivator, but that autonomy, mastery, and purpose are at least as powerful. Autonomy gives people a great deal of latitude in determining how they will complete their tasks. Mastery allows them to keep getting better at something meaningful. Purpose gives everyone a reason to work beyond self-interest.
#3 Treat Customers Like Donors – They Have a Choice
Like nonprofits, businesses need to nurture ongoing relationships with their customers. Our local philanthropic leaders thank their relationships often. Successful for-profit companies and nonprofits alike share interesting company news, such as advances in energy efficiency or new technology breakthroughs, and embrace how customer loyalty helped make it possible.
